Pigdown Farm Cottages is a characterful Grade 2 listed semi-detached house, dating in part to the 16th Century, on a peaceful rural lane on the outskirts of the sought-after and historic village of Hever (the cottage was part of the Hever Castle estate until the 1980s). It lies on the northern edge of the beautiful High Weald National Landscape and with few other houses in close proximity the outlook is predominantly across unspoilt fields and the surrounding woodland.

The cottage, which has been extensively renovated over the last few months and is to let unfurnished, includes:

- entrance hall
- generous dual-aspect sitting-room with sash windows, new coir carpet, cast-iron radiator and open fireplace
- dining room with original parquet flooring, cast-iron radiator, inglenook fireplace with woodburner and original timbers
- fitted kitchen with Shaker style units, quarry tile floor, double sink, new fridge-freezer and new washing machine
- downstairs WC/cloakroom with new fittings and brick flooring
- upstairs bathroom (with shower over L-shaped bath)
- master bedroom with original wide oak floorboards, open fireplace and separate walk-in closet
- second bedroom with fitted carpet
- attic room (accessible by retractable ladder) for storage only
- cellar (for storage only)

There are front and rear enclosed gardens including a lavender lined brick path to the front door, lawns, flower beds, gravel paths and seating area.

On-street parking available opposite the house for at least two cars.

Dogs and other pets are welcome by prior agreement.

Central heating is provided by a modern Grant oil-fired combination boiler (to be serviced annually by the tenant) and Full Fibre broadband was installed in 2023.

Council Tax is Band F with Sevenoaks District Council (payable by the tenant along with water, electricity and oil).

Pigdown Lane is a quiet single-track road with views across to the Chart Hills and North Downs, with minimal traffic (mostly sheep and horses from the farm next-door!) and lying mid-way between the attractive villages of Hever and Markbeech, home to two excellent pubs and Falconhurst Farm Shop. The small town of Edenbridge is a 10 minute drive and offers several supermarkets (including a Waitrose), two petrol stations and numerous shops, restaurants, takeaways etc.
